In Mrs. Buddenberg’s second-grade class, students have been learning all about nutrition and how to take care of their bodies. They’ve explored different body systems, the important nutrients needed to stay healthy, and how the foods they eat help fuel their bodies each day.
To put their knowledge into action, students sorted a variety of foods into the correct groups. Then, they designed their own balanced meals on paper plates, making sure to include each of the five food groups. Their plates were filled with creative ideas and healthy choices!

🦖 Learning Like Real Paleontologists! 🦴
Our first grade DLI students were fully immersed in hands-on learning in both English and Spanish while exploring the fascinating world of fossils!
First, students created their own dinosaur fossils, learning what paleontologists discover and the stage in which fossils are found. Then, they stamped animals and plants into clay to model another way fossils can form and to better understand how this process happens in real life.
Next, students became true paleontologists by carefully excavating fossils from a “rock.” Their rock was a chocolate chip cookie, and they had to slowly carve out the chocolate chips just like scientists carefully uncover fossils in real life. 🍪🔎
Finally, we wrapped up our exploration by enjoying a delicious “Layers of the Earth” pudding, where students identified and named each layer while learning about Earth’s structure. 🌎
What a fun, engaging, and delicious way to learn about science! Our young scientists did an amazing job investigating, discovering, and thinking like real paleontologists. 👩🔬👨🔬✨
